LAND USE AGENDA
TOWN OF BROWNSBURG
BOARD OF ZONING APPEALS
WHK, LLC, 2010-05BZA. The Petitioner, Richard Gardner, provided a very nice
presentation regarding a use variance from the zoning ordinance for lot number
8 in the William E. Thompson Subdivision commonly known as 21 North Grant Street in Brownsburg, Indiana. Mr. Gardner seeks permission to use the
property as a residence in the C-3 commercial district after a complete remodel
of the existing property including the construction of an attached garage. Mr.
Gardner explained that he and his wife plan to live at the property following
the conversion of it into a home. They
have been cleaning up the property for several months. The original plans as presented are being
modified to include only a two car garage.
The third bay, originally planned to house an automobile, will be
instead converted into a breezeway. All
neighbors on North Grant Street
have been previously notified of the plans and all support the plans. Banning Engineering is the project
engineer. The BZA hearing date is April 12, 2010. Ken Roe made a motion to support the
petition as presented with the anticipated modifications to the plans. A second was made to the motion by Mike Starkey
and a roll call vote of the Directors present revealed that the motion passed
by a vote of 6-0-0 (Support-Oppose-Abstain).

BROWNSBURG
SQUARE, 2010-05P. Petitioner Elaine
Ash was not present for the meeting. She
seeks to rezone lot number 2 in Brownsburg
Square which consistsof
3.7 acres from I-1 to C-3 so that the zoning is consistent with the current use
of the property. A very brief discussion
on this petition was had before Mike Starkey made a motion to support
the petition as presented. A second was
made to the motion by Ken Roe and a roll call vote of the Directors present
revealed that the motion passed by a vote of 6-0-0 (Support-Oppose-Abstain). The BAPAC hearing
date on this petition is April
26, 2010.
